ON DUPLICATE KEY UPDATE注意事项2015-07-17 09:14:24
MySQL 自4.1版以后开始支持INSERT ON DUPLICATE KEY UPDATE语法,使得原本需要执行3条SQL语句(SELECT,INSERT,UPDATE),缩减为1条语句即可完成。 例如ipstats表结构如下: 引用 CREATE TABLE ipstats ( ip VARCHAR(15) NOT NULL UNIQUE, clicks SMALLINT(5)
修改MySQL的root密码(Linux环境)2015-07-17 09:14:24
第一种方法: root用户登录系统 /usr/local/mysql/bin/mysqladmin -u root -p password 新密码 enter password 旧密码 第二种方法: root用户登录mysql数据库 mysql update mysql.user set password=password(新密码)where User=root; mysql flush privile
MYSQL中ERROR 1005信息处理2015-07-17 09:14:24
在使用MYsql的时候,在操作不当时,很容易出现 ERROR 1005 (HY000): Can't create table 这类错误。很多站长朋友可能需要排查很久才会找到问题的原因其实很简单,希望这篇文章可以对站长朋友以及Mysql初学者一点帮助。 MYSQL官方提供的问题原因: 在信息中有
MYSQL导入数据Got a packet bigger than...错误2015-07-17 09:14:22
昨天用导入数据的时候发现有的地方有这个错误。后来才发现我用RPM包装的MYSQL配置文件里面有old_passwords=1去掉就可以了。 Got a packet bigger than max_allowed_packet bytes or ERROR 1153 (08S01) at line 616: Got a packet bigger than max_allowed_p
mysql INSERT command denied to user2015-07-17 09:14:22
错误编号: 1142 问题分析: 网站运行突然出现下面的 MySQL 错误: MySQL server error report: INSERT command denied to user '%s'@'localhost' for table '%s' , errno: 1142 解决办法: 1、请检查您的 MySQL 帐号是否有相应的权限。 2、检查一下应用
Query was empty是什么错误2015-07-17 09:14:21
错误编号: 1065 问题分析: 无效的 SQL 语句,SQL 语句为空。 解决方法: 检查所执行的 SQL 语句是否为空。如果为空,请设置需要执行的数据库操作语句。如果您是由于安装插件或者修改代码造成此错误,请重新上传程序。
linux下MYSQL常见两个错误的解决办法2015-07-17 09:14:20
问题1:登录mysql的错误 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2) 解决方法: 1)默认的mysql.sock文件是在/tmp目录下。 2)我们建立一个软连接,ln -s /tmp/mysql.sock /var/lib/mysql/mysq
MySQL命令终端有beep声2015-07-17 09:14:20
使用MySQL的命令终端时,如果输入SQL有误,将有beep声。若要关闭该功能,根据mysql --help,使用mysql --no-beep即可。 修改my.ini 在[mysql] 下加入一行 no-beep 最后重新启动MySQL数据库就可以了
MYSQL初学者扫盲2015-07-17 09:14:19
先 Create table 吧 create table emp( id int not null primary key, name varchar(10) ); create table emp_dept( dept_id varchar(4) not null, emp_id int not null, emp_name varchar(10), primary key (dept_id,emp_id)); insert into emp() values (1
MySQL教程:Order By用法2015-07-17 09:14:18
先按照下面的表结构创建mysql_order_by_test数据表,我们用实例一点一点告诉你,MySQL order by的用法。 ORDER BY uid ASC 按照uid正序查询数据,也就是按照uid从小到大排列 ORDER BY uid DESC 按照uid逆序查询数据,也就是按照uid从大到小排列 我们来看 SEL

相关栏目

推荐MYSQL